California statutes of limitations vary by claim type. It is important to begin with a free consultation to determine deadlines and preserve evidence. Early action helps protect your rights and improve the chances for a favorable outcome.
Damages in product liability cases typically include medical expenses, lost wages, future care costs, and pain and suffering. The exact amount depends on the injuries and long-term impact. A thorough evaluation helps ensure you pursue all eligible losses.
Yes. Keep all packaging, labels, manuals, and recall notices. These documents can help establish defect, labeling failures, or warnings that were missing or unclear.
Product liability refers to the legal responsibility of manufacturers or sellers for injuries caused by defective drugs or devices. It often involves design flaws, manufacturing errors, or inadequate warnings.
Whether a case goes to trial depends on the specifics. Many cases are resolved through settlements, but we prepare thoroughly for trial to protect your rights if a fair settlement cannot be reached.
Fault often involves proving defect, causation, and damages. In medical device cases, expert analysis on design, manufacturing, and how the device caused harm is typical to establish liability.
